Aarti Industries achieves EcoVadis Platinum, ranks in global top 1%

ESG Broadcast Desk· 4 Jun 2026· 1 min read

Aarti Industries Limited has been awarded the EcoVadis Platinum Rating 2026, with a score of 87 out of 100, placing it among the top 1% of companies assessed globally. The achievement marks a ten-year improvement of 49 points since the company first scored 38 in 2017.

Aarti Industries Limited (AIL), a leading global speciality chemicals manufacturer, announced on 4 June 2026 that it has received the EcoVadis Platinum Rating for 2026 after scoring 87 out of 100 — up from 78 in the previous assessment cycle. EcoVadis is one of the world's most widely used third-party sustainability rating platforms, evaluating companies across four pillars: Environment, Labour and Human Rights, Ethics, and Sustainable Procurement. The Platinum designation places Aarti Industries in the top 1% of all companies globally assessed by EcoVadis.

The score improvement from 38 in 2017 to 87 in 2026 reflects a decade of deliberate sustainability investment and institutional commitment across Aarti's supply chain and operations. Global customers and procurement teams increasingly rely on EcoVadis ratings as a prerequisite for supplier qualification, making the Platinum tier a commercially strategic as well as reputationally significant achievement. The rating reinforces Aarti's position as a preferred sustainability-aligned supplier in international chemicals markets.
